How to Stay Hard After You Come: What Actually Works

Staying fully erect after ejaculation is difficult because your body actively works against it. Within seconds of orgasm, your brain triggers a cascade of chemical changes designed to shut down arousal and redirect blood away from the penis. This recovery window, called the refractory period, can last anywhere from a few minutes in younger men to 12 to 24 hours in older men. You can’t eliminate it entirely, but you can shorten it and use specific strategies to maintain enough firmness to keep going.

Why Erections Fade After Orgasm

The moment you ejaculate, a group of specialized nerve cells in your spinal cord sends a signal to your brain using a chemical messenger called galanin. This signal essentially flips a switch: the brain regions responsible for sexual arousal rapidly power down. Glutamate, the brain chemical that drives arousal, spikes to about three times its normal level during ejaculation and then crashes back to baseline almost immediately. The steeper that crash, the longer your refractory period lasts.

At the same time, serotonin levels rise in parts of the brain that regulate sexual behavior, actively suppressing your desire and ability to stay aroused. Your brain also sends inhibitory signals down the spinal cord to the nerves controlling erection, essentially telling the blood vessels in your penis to relax and let blood drain out. This is a coordinated, multi-system shutdown, not just a single hormone switch you can easily override.

Prolactin, the hormone most commonly blamed for the refractory period, plays a smaller role than most people think. Research in neuroscience reviews has found that prolactin is not a substantial cause of the refractory period’s onset, though it may contribute to its later stages. The real drivers are the rapid shifts in brain signaling chemicals and the inhibitory nerve signals from the brainstem.

Constriction Rings: The Most Direct Solution

A constriction ring (sometimes called a cock ring) placed at the base of the penis physically restricts blood from draining out. This is the most straightforward way to maintain firmness after orgasm, because it works against the mechanical process of detumescence rather than trying to override brain chemistry. The ring gently compresses the veins that normally carry blood away from the penis, keeping the erectile tissue engorged even as your nervous system signals it to deflate.

Material matters for safety. Medical-grade silicone or elastomer rings are the recommended choice because they’re body-safe, easy to clean, and flexible enough to remove without difficulty. Multi-piece or magnetic designs offer the safest removal. Avoid rigid metal rings, which can cause penile entrapment if the erection doesn’t subside. That’s a genuine medical emergency that sometimes requires bolt cutters in an emergency room. Leather is also a poor choice because it harbors bacteria and is difficult to sanitize.

Don’t wear a constriction ring for extended periods. If you notice numbness, coldness, or skin color changes, remove it immediately. Used correctly, though, these devices are one of the few tools that can keep you functional through the early minutes of the refractory period when your brain is working hardest to shut things down.

Pelvic Floor Training for Better Blood Flow Control

Your pelvic floor muscles play a direct role in controlling blood flow to the penis and maintaining erections. Strengthening them through Kegel exercises gives you more voluntary control over engorgement, which can help you hold firmness longer after orgasm and regain erections faster.

The routine is simple. Squeeze the muscles you’d use to stop urinating midstream, hold for five seconds, then relax for five seconds. Repeat 10 times per session, three sessions per day. Count out loud to avoid holding your breath. Over time, work up to 10-second holds with 10-second rests. These muscles respond to training like any other, so consistency over weeks matters more than intensity on any single day. The payoff is greater control over both erection maintenance and ejaculation timing.

Reducing Prolactin’s Role

While prolactin isn’t the primary trigger for the refractory period, it does contribute to the feeling of “done” that follows orgasm. In a clinical study, men given a prolactin-lowering medication showed significantly enhanced sexual drive and improved perception of the refractory period compared to baseline. Their sense of sexual satisfaction and readiness to continue both increased.

Prescription prolactin-lowering drugs aren’t practical or appropriate for most men just looking to go another round. But understanding this mechanism points to a useful insight: anything that keeps your dopamine levels higher naturally can work against prolactin’s effects, since the two hormones have an inverse relationship. Physical fitness, adequate sleep, and managing stress all support healthy dopamine signaling. Zinc-rich foods (oysters, red meat, pumpkin seeds) also support testosterone production, which indirectly keeps the dopamine-prolactin balance tilted in your favor.

Nutrition and Supplements

L-arginine is an amino acid your body uses to produce nitric oxide, the molecule that relaxes blood vessels and allows blood to flow into the penis in the first place. Supplementing with it can support erectile function over time, though it’s not an instant fix. The typical dosage ranges from 6 to 30 grams daily, split into three doses, and it can take up to three months of consistent use to see full effects.

You can also get L-arginine from protein-rich foods: red meat, salmon, almonds, cashews, pumpkin seeds, chickpeas, and brown rice are all good sources. A diet that consistently supplies these building blocks gives your body better raw materials for producing the nitric oxide needed to achieve and maintain erections. This won’t override the refractory period on its own, but it stacks with other strategies to improve your baseline erectile function.

Practical Strategies That Don’t Require Supplements

Several behavioral approaches can help you stay in the game after orgasm. The first is simply not stopping all stimulation. During the refractory period, your brain is suppressing arousal signals, but continued physical contact and mental engagement can keep some arousal pathways active. Switching to manual or oral stimulation of your partner buys time while keeping you in a sexual context, which makes it easier to regain an erection than if you completely disengage.

Edging, the practice of bringing yourself close to orgasm and backing off repeatedly before finally finishing, trains your body to tolerate high arousal without immediately crashing. Over time, this can give you better control over the orgasm itself and may reduce the severity of the post-ejaculation shutdown. Some men also find that a less intense orgasm (achieved by reducing stimulation right at the point of no return) produces a milder refractory period than a full-force climax.

Cardiovascular fitness makes a measurable difference. Erections depend on blood flow, and better cardiovascular health means more efficient blood delivery and retention. Men who exercise regularly tend to report shorter refractory periods and stronger erections overall. Even moderate aerobic activity, like brisk walking for 30 minutes most days, improves the vascular function that erections depend on.

What Age Changes

Refractory periods lengthen with age, and there’s wide individual variation at every stage. Younger men in their teens and twenties may recover in minutes. By middle age, the window commonly stretches to an hour or more. Men over 50 or 60 often experience refractory periods of 12 to 24 hours. These aren’t hard limits, and overall health, libido, and lifestyle factors create significant variation from person to person.

The strategies above become more important as you age, precisely because the neurochemical shutdown becomes more pronounced and recovery slows. Pelvic floor strength, cardiovascular fitness, and consistent nutrition all have compounding effects over time. A constriction ring remains effective regardless of age, since it works mechanically rather than by fighting your brain chemistry. The most realistic approach combines physical aids for the immediate moment with longer-term training and lifestyle habits that gradually shift your baseline recovery time shorter.
